epigraphdb: Interface Package for the 'EpiGraphDB' Platform

The interface package to access data from the 'EpiGraphDB' <https://epigraphdb.org> platform. It provides easy access to the 'EpiGraphDB' platform with functions that query the corresponding REST endpoints on the API <https://api.epigraphdb.org> and return the response data in the 'tibble' data frame format.
